Understanding the Stray Round

The MCC NEET UG Counselling process includes a crucial phase known as the Stray Round. This round is designed to fill any vacant seats that remain after the initial rounds of counselling have concluded. It offers students an additional opportunity to secure a place in medical colleges across the country.

During the Stray Round, candidates who have not yet been allotted a seat can participate, provided they meet the eligibility criteria. This round is often characterized by a rapid decision-making process, emphasizing the need for candidates to stay alert to the announcements made by the Medical Counselling Committee (MCC).
